Ver Mensaje Individual
  #1 (permalink)  
Antiguo 09/08/2011, 15:00
Avatar de JavierMMM
JavierMMM
 
Fecha de Ingreso: agosto-2008
Ubicación: Justito frente a la computadora.
Mensajes: 278
Antigüedad: 16 años, 2 meses
Puntos: 0
Pregunta Retornar dos valores

Hola, de nuevo con una pregunta, que quizás sea muy sencilla de contestar, pero he encontrado algunas cosas en google y dentro de este mismo foro, pero no resuelve mi problema.

Tengo una consulta en asp donde verifico el nombre y id. Lo que requiero es, imrpimir el nombre en un textbox que tengo en mi div, lo cual ya me funciona de maravilla, y además requiero enviarle a un type=hidden el id, pero no he podido.

este es mi div:
Código HTML:
Ver original
  1. Código del Curso:
  2. <input type="text" name="ccursoa" id="ccursoa" size="11" />
  3. <input type="button" onClick="buscarcursoal(var2=document.getElementById('ccursoa').value)" value="Buscar" />
  4.  
  5. <input type="hidden" id="id" name="id" value="id de la consulta" />
  6.  
  7. Curso: <input type="text" name="calumno" id="calumno" size="67" />

de esta manera mando llamar la consulta
Código Javascript:
Ver original
  1. function buscarcursoal(var2)
  2. {
  3.     var valor;
  4.     valor = 5;
  5.     ajax=nuevoAjax();
  6.     //document.write(valor+" - "+var2);
  7.     ajax.open("GET", "curso.asp?tipo="+valor+"&variable="+var2, true);
  8.     ajax.onreadystatechange=function()
  9.     {
  10.         if (ajax.readyState==4)
  11.         {
  12.             //y quiero saber como puedo regresar la variable id de la consulta
  13.             document.registroins.calumno.value = ajax.responseText;
  14.         }
  15.     }
  16.     ajax.send(null);
  17. }

aquí hago la consulta:

Código ASP:
Ver original
  1. Set oConn = Server.CreateObject("ADODB.Connection")
  2. Set Rs = Server.CreateObject("ADODB.Recordset")
  3. oConn.open = "DSN=cnx;UID=;PWD=;DATABASE="
  4.  
  5. Set Rs = Server.CreateObject("ADODB.Recordset")
  6. consulta = "SELECT id, codigo, nombre FROM CURSOS WHERE codigo = '"&variable&"'"
  7. Rs.Open consulta, oConn
  8.  
  9.     Response.Write Rs("nombre")
  10.         ´aqui es donde quiero poner la var id
  11.  
  12. Rs.Close
  13. Set Rs = Nothing
  14. oConn.Close
  15. Set oConn = Nothing

espero me puedan apoyar para regresar esa variable.

Gracias
__________________
__________________________________________________ ___________________________________
Las cosas más reales sólo suceden en la imaginación... Sólo recordamos, lo que nunca sucedió.